In today’s episode, Beau sits down with fellow Allstate agent and friend Nicholas Sakha. Nicholas Sakha was born and raised in San Diego. He comes from a big family, and at a young age, he would start any opportunity to work and make money. He would work in neighbor’s yards, and he worked multiple jobs including his cousin’s pizza place, the cafeteria in high school, Subway, delivering pizza, selling sunglasses, and network marketing.

Seven years ago, he moved to Las Vegas to work as a banker. During his time in banking, Nicholas earned his bachelor’s degree in business management. He always knew he wanted to own a business, but didn’t know what. His friend encouraged him to open a scratch insurance agency in 2016. Six years later, his business has hit $11,000,000, he has thirteen staff members, and three locations.

Nicholas also has his own podcast called Barbells and Briefcases and he is beginning to offer courses in how to grow an insurance agency.
